Allied Health and Medical Assisting Services programs in Ohio

Compare 31 reporting programs using the same federal field and credential definition. Earnings are observed four years after completion.

31Programs reporting earnings
$42,400Median year-4 earnings
$22,000Median federal debt
27Programs reporting debt

ALL REPORTING PROGRAMS

Compare every available outcome

Sorted by observed year-4 earnings. Open a row for its exact college-and-degree profile.

#CollegeCityMedian year-4 earningsMedian federal debt
1Kent State University at AshtabulaAshtabula$47,406$28,878
2Kent State University at East LiverpoolEast Liverpool$47,406$28,878
3Kent State University at KentKent$47,406$28,878
4Kent State University at GeaugaBurton$47,406$28,878
5Sinclair Community CollegeDayton$47,282$18,225
6Hocking CollegeNelsonville$46,668$17,146
7University of Cincinnati-Main CampusCincinnati$46,526$25,875
8University of Cincinnati-Clermont CollegeBatavia$46,526$25,875
9University of Cincinnati-Blue Ash CollegeBlue Ash$46,526$25,875
10Lorain County Community CollegeElyria$46,146$26,750
11Owens Community CollegePerrysburg$45,537$19,649
12Herzing University-AkronAkron$44,890$29,500
13Shawnee State UniversityPortsmouth$44,869$16,999
14Cuyahoga Community College DistrictCleveland$44,042$17,500
15Professional Skills InstituteMaumee$43,786Not available
16North Central State CollegeMansfield$42,400$13,667
17Clark State CollegeSpringfield$42,330$21,084
18Zane State CollegeZanesville$42,061$12,966
19Terra State Community CollegeFremont$42,025Not available
20Cincinnati State Technical and Community CollegeCincinnati$41,670$22,525
21Marion Technical CollegeMarion$40,296$14,196
22Washington State College of OhioMarietta$40,284$16,500
23Bryant & Stratton College-ParmaParma$40,225$24,200
24Ross College-SylvaniaSylvania$39,773$15,608
25James A. Rhodes State CollegeLima$39,389$9,929
26ATA College-CincinnatiCincinnati$39,009$25,563
27University of Akron Main CampusAkron$38,437$22,000
28Remington College-Cleveland CampusCleveland$37,677$24,121
29University of Northwestern OhioLima$35,625Not available
30Stark State CollegeNorth Canton$34,844$20,364
31Northwest State Community CollegeArchbold$30,960Not available

This is an observed-outcomes comparison, not a universal quality ranking. Missing and privacy-suppressed programs are excluded.
